  • Patent number: 8728775
    Abstract: The present invention relates to a method for preparing 2-pyrrolidone using biomass, comprising: a step (a) of culturing a microorganism which contains glutamate decarboxylase as a whole-cell catalyst in a culture medium containing glutamic acid or glutamate so as to prepare 4-amino butyric acid; a step (b) of filtering the 4-amino butyric acid from the culture medium in order to obtain the 4-amino butyric acid; and a step (c) of converting the 4-amino butyric acid into 2-pyrrolidone. The present invention provides a series of processes for preparing 2-pyrrolidone from glutamic acid or glutamate using biomass. According to the present invention, 4-amino butyric acid is prepared using a microorganism as a whole cell, and preferably, 4-amino butyric acid which has not undergone a complicated refining process such as a crystallization process is directly used to prepare 2-pyrrolidone at a high yield rate in an economically advantageous manner.

  • Patent number: 7906206
    Abstract: An organic insulator composition comprising a high dielectric constant insulator dispersed in a hyperbranched polymer and an organic thin film transistor using the insulator composition. More specifically, the organic thin film transistor comprises a substrate, a gate electrode, a gate insulating layer, a source electrode, a drain electrode and an organic semiconductor layer wherein the gate insulating layer is made of the organic insulator composition. The use of the insulator composition in the formation of a gate insulating layer allows the gate insulating layer to be uniformly formed by spin coating at room temperature, as well as enables fabrication of an organic thin film transistor simultaneously satisfying the requirements of high charge carrier mobility and low threshold voltage.

  • Publication number: 20110040717
    Abstract: Disclosed is a process for ranking semantic web resources, comprising the steps of; establishing an RDF knowledge base using diverse tools that support the establishment of ontologies; setting, by class, object and subject weights for an object type attribute and a weight for a data type attribute on the schema composed of classes that constitute a domain and of attributes that describe relationships between these classes; extracting from the RDF knowledge base an RDF triple composed of three portions, i.e., a subject, a predicate and an object; creating a weight matrix of class-oriented attributes based on a set weight and the extracted RDF triple; and operating the created weight matrix of class-oriented attributes to calculate a first eigenvector and obtain a vector for ranking scores of resources.

  • Publication number: 20100326504
    Abstract: The present invention relates to a solar cell and a fabrication method thereof, whereby the method includes doping a silicon substrate having a first conductive type impurity with a second conductive type impurity, the second conductive type impurity being opposite to the first conductive type impurity, and thereby forming an emitter layer at a front surface part of the silicon substrate; forming an antireflection film on the emitter layer; forming a front electrode on the antireflection film; forming a rear electrode on a rear surface of the silicon substrate; and forming a back surface field layer at a rear surface part of the silicon substrate, the back surface field layer having a concentration of the first conductive type impurity that is higher than that of the silicon substrate, the back surface field layer having a different concentration of the second conductive type impurity from that of the emitter layer.
